Ingredients
Herbed Paneer Dip
1/4 cup chopped parsley
1 cup grated paneer (cottage cheese)
1/4 cup whisked curds (dahi)
1/4 cup milk
1/2 tsp dried oregano
1 tsp dry red chilli flakes (paprika)
salt to taste

To make parsley paneer dip, first grate 1 cup of paneer in a mixer jar. Ensure that you use freshly made paneer. Click here to Learn how to make paneer step-by-step.
-
To this add ¼ cup of whisked curd. This will help in getting a smoother dip.
-
Add parsley. This is used to perk up the flavour of the paneer dip with herbs. You can replace the parsley with dill leaves or celery if you wish to.
-
Add milk to it. This will help in blending all the ingredients well.
-
Blend all the ingredients of parsley paneer dip till smooth. This is how it looks after blending.
-
Transfer the blended mixture of the dip into a deep bowl.
-
Add the oregano. You can use dried mixed herbs as an option.
-
Add chilli flakes to make parsley paneer dip | herbed paneer dip | paneer dip with herbs | paneer dip with parsley | slightly spicy.
-
Add salt as per taste.
-
Mix well using a spoon.
- Refrigerate herbed paneer dip for atleast 1 hour.
-
Serve parsley paneer dip | herbed paneer dip | paneer dip with herbs | paneer dip with parsley | chilled with cucumber and carrot sticks.
